1. AMD Radeon RX 6600 XT

The AMD Radeon RX 6600 XT, so far, is the best cheap graphics card in the market in terms of performance, costing close to $500 on amazon. It supports Ray Tracing and has a base clock speed of 2064 MHz. It can be overclocked up to 2607 MHz. It has a DDR6 memory of 8GB, which can allow you to run graphics intensive games like Red Dead Redemption 2, Call of Duty Modern Warfare 2, Horizon Zero Dawn, etc. games with high textures enables. This graphics card is suitable for 1080p, and performs better even at high temperatures. It also consumes only 160W, so you may not need to upgrade your PSU. However, this GPU is not fully capable of running 1440p 60FPS, so keep that in mind.

2. GeForce RTX 3050

The GeForce RTX 3050 is the best budget graphics card when the price is more important. It has a reasonable cost of close to $300 on amazon. As the name suggests, it supports Ray Tracing. It has a base clock of 1552 MHZ which can be boosted upto 1777 MHz. Like the Radeon RX 6600 XT, it has 8GB DDR6 memory, allowing you to run graphics intensive games with high textures. It has a great 1080p performance and can keep the chip cool. But don't look forward to 1440p gaming with it.

3. AMD Radeon RX 6600

The AMD Radeon RX 6600 is a downgraded version of AMD Radeon RX 6600 XT and has slightly better performance and lower price compared to the RTX 3050. So if you have no problem with AMD GPUs, then definitely choose this one instead of RTX 3050. It costs only $237 on amazon, which indeed is a bang for the buck. It supports ray tracing. It has a base clock of 1626 MHz which can be boosted up to 2491 MHz. It has an 8GB DDR6 memory, more than enough for running graphics intensive games (e.g. RDR2) with high textures. It has excellent 1080p performance but not really good for 1440p.

4. Radeon RX 5700

If you don't need ray tracing, then the RX 5700 is the best cheap graphics card for you. Providing that you don't want ray tracing, it is a bang for the buck costing only $174 on amazon. It has a base clock of 1465 MHz which can be incrased to 1725 MHz. Like the GPUs mentioned above, it also has a DDR6 memory of 8 GB, which allows you to run highly intensive games with high textures. The good thing is that this GPU is good for 1440p gaming at high graphics setting, unlike the previous GPUs.

5. GTX 1660 Super

If you are looking for only NVDIA, you don't need ray tracing, then this is the best cheap graphics card for you. It has a cost of $277 on amazon, which is not the most reasonable one. It has a similar clock speed compared to the previous ones. It has a base clock of 1520 MHz and overclocked speed of 1785 MHz. Unlike the orevious GPUs, it has a lower DDR6 memory of 6GB. Still, it can run most games with Ultra textures. It has a good 1080p performance, but cannot handle 1440p that effectively.
